TKR Single Phase Power Relay Type Ac Voltage Stabilizer For Home

TKR 1-5Kva Single Phase Power Relay Type Ac Voltage Stabilizer For Home

Capacity: 0.5KVA up to 5KVA
Phase: single phase
Precision: ±10%(Adjustable)
Control type: Relay Type

Protect your household appliances from sudden voltage fluctuations with our 1–5KVA Single Phase Relay Type AC Voltage Stabilizer. Designed specifically for residential use, this compact and cost-effective solution ensures your devices run safely and efficiently—even when the mains voltage is unstable.
